Courts Jail 12 Internet Fraudsters Who Defrauded Foreign National With Fake Social Media Accounts In Adamawa

Twelve suspected internet fraudsters have been sentenced and convicted to various jail terms by State High Court, in Adamawa State.

The suspects who were being prosecuted by the EFCC were sentenced by Justices Kayanson Samuel Lawanson, Hammed Isha, Benjamin Manji Lawal and Mohammed Ibrahim Tola of the Adamawa State High Courts.

The convicts are: Oladele Pius, Emmanuel Bulus, Elijah Elisha, Alamin Mohammed Bappa, Jamilu Usman, and Enoch Solomon

Others are: Emmanuel Anthony, Enebeli Samuel Isreal, Dimas Hyellabulatin, Emmanuel Dike, Joshua Umoru and Dan Eden Sunday.

They were separately arraigned between November 6 and 7, 2024 on a one count charge of cheating and impersonation by the Gombe Zonal Directorate of the EFCC.

The charge against Alamin Muhammad Bappa reads: “Alamin Muhammad Bappa sometimes in September, 2024 at Sangere area of Modibo Yola, Adamawa State within the jurisdiction of this Honourable Court with intent to defraud one Amity Shane and other unsuspecting foreign nationals, created some fake Gmail’ and Facebook accounts using the name Jacob sermon to pose as a cybersecurity professional that helps people to recover their compromised or blocked Facebook accounts for a service fee of $20 each and thereby committed an offense of cheating by impersonation contrary to Section 314 of Penal Code Law of Adamawa State, 2018 and punishable under Section 315 of the same law”.

The charge against Oladele Pius reads: “ that you Oladele Pius sometimes in September, 2024 in Yola, Adamawa State within the jurisdiction of this Honourable Court, being a student of Modibo Adamawa University of Technology Yola, with intent to defraud, did cheat by Impersonation, having created and operating one Mr. Legit Hassan Abbadin a foreign national with Whatsapp account No. +1 (842) 921332016, through your Your iphone 11 Model No. MWNC2CH/A for ” a virtual funds transactions” with a motive of gaining a financial advantage from other unsuspecting internet users and thereby committed an offense of cheating by impersonation contrary to Section 314 of Penal Code Law of Adamawa State, 2018 and punishable under Section 315 of the same law

Upon arraignment, the defendants pleaded guilty to their respective charges, prompting prosecution counsel Saad .H Sa’ad and M.D Aliyu to pray the court to convict and sentence the defendants accordingly; however, counsels to the defendants pleaded with the court to temper justice with mercy .

Justice Lawanson thereafter convicted and sentenced Bulus , Elisha , Usman and Israel to ten years imprisonment or a fine of N200,000 (Two Hundred Thousand Naira) each. However, Hyellabulati bagged five years imprisonment or a fine of N200,000

Justice Tola convicted and sentenced Dike , Umoru , Sunday and Pius to five years imprisonment with an option of fine of N2,000,000( Two Million Naira )each

Justice Lawal convicted and sentenced Bappa and Solomon to five years imprisonment or a fine of N200,000 each.

Justice Isha convicted and sentenced Anthony to ten years imprisonment or a fine of N300,000 (Three hundred thousand Naira)

The Judges ruled that the mobile phones recovered during investigation be forfeited to the Federal Government of Nigeria .

In addition, Justice Lawal ordered that the sum of $20 recovered during investigation from Bappa and being proceeds of crime, be returned to the victim.

The convicts were arrested on September 24, 2024 around Modibo Adamawa University of Technology area of Yola, Adamawa State by operatives of the Commission following actionable intelligence linking them with cybercrimes activities. They were charged to court and convicted.
